As one of the summer’s top transfer stories was set to be concluded, we have an anti-climax of sorts as Brazilian wonderkid Lucas Moura’s agent has dropped a bombshell at Old Trafford by publicly stating that the deal is officially off.
English giants Manchester United were set to seal the deal on Lucas after chasing him for nearly the entire summer, as manager Sir Alex Ferguson was keen to add a marquee signing this summer, and had earmarked Lucas as the perfect candidate to lead his midfield attack next season alongside new recruit, Japanese Shinji Kagawa.
Lucas’ club back in Brazil, Sao Paulo had made it clear that they would only consider selling their prized asset if a bumper offer came their way as they were looking at a fees in the region of above £30 million. The Red Devils made an official bid which did not meet Sao Paulo’s valuation, and was hence rejected as the Brazilian outfit were holding out for more.
With United reconsidering spending that huge amount on a 19-year old, Lucas’ agent Wagner Ribeiro believes that United’s second thoughts have cost him the midfield superstar. Speaking to UOL, Ribeiro said, ”They have reached their limit,”
Lucas Moura won’t leave. He is happy at Sao Paulo. We have to forget this subject. There is no possibility he leaves now.
Manchester United made an offer, which was rejected and they won’t make another one as they have reached their limit.”
